Galatasaray Head Coach Delivers Major Transfer Update On Inter Milan Midfielder: 'President Wants Him Here'
Galatasaray head coach Okan Buruk insists the Turkish champions haven't withdrawn from the race for Inter Milan star Hakan Calhanoglu. Speaking to BeIN Sports via FCInterNews, Buruk confirmed the club's overwhelming desire to sign the 31-year-old. Despite falling behind Fenerbahce in the pecking order, the reigning Super Lig holders remain keen on Calhanoglu. Indeed, Buruk's men are reluctant to concede defeat just yet. Meanwhile, Fenerbahce have intensified talks with the player's agent as they look to wrap the deal up in the coming hours. However, Fenerbahce's aggressive approach has not deterred Galatasaray from making a late bid. Instead, the Rams Park outfit may try to hijack Calhanoglu's transfer to the Sukru Saracoglu Stadium at the 11th hour. As for Inter, their hands seem tied as the Turkish midfielder undoubtedly wants to leave. (Photo by) Time is ticking away, but Galatasaray haven't lost hope of signing Hakan Calhanoglu. Indeed, they have been preoccupied with other transfer dealings. After landing Leroy Sane, they went to great lengths to re-sign Victor Osimhen from Napoli. Now that the Nigerian is on the verge of returning to Istanbul, Galatasaray can turn back to Calhanoglu. 'This is the wish of our president, and it's our intention as well. In reality, we're trying to move forward position by position,' Buruk stated. 'We quickly finalized Leroy Sané. Victor Osimhen was very important to confirm, and his transfer is almost complete. 'Once that is finalized, the goalkeeper's transfer will be particularly important for us. 'We need to make decisions on other positions as we go along. The most important thing, of course, is to have a budget. 'We allocated a very significant budget for Osimhen, and we have to make decisions based on the remaining budget. 'Here, you can ask for a lot – you can ask for players in every position – but the budget is very important. We have to use it wisely.'

Luis Diaz's Liverpool future in spotlight amid Bayern Munich interest
Liverpool have rejected an opening offer of €67.5m from Bayern Munich for forward Luis Diaz. The club remains adamant that the Colombian international is not for sale and is considered a key player until his contract ends in 2027. Liverpool believe Diaz is worth over €100m, citing prices for other high-class forwards and interest from the Saudi Pro League. Barcelona had also shown interest in Diaz but were informed he was unavailable, leading them to pursue other targets. Bayern Munich are seeking a replacement for winger Leroy Sane, who joined Galatasaray, and are also without Thomas Muller and the injured Jamal Musiala.

Sané: Germany need Musiala to recover and deliver 'brilliant moments'
Munich players Leroy Sane (L) and Jamal Musiala take a seat on the bench before the FIFA Club World Cup round of 16 soccer match between CR Flamengo and Bayern Munich at the Hard Rock Stadium. Sven Hoppe/dpa Leroy Sané hailed Germany team-mate Jamal Musiala as a difference maker as he wished his former Bayern Munich colleague a speedy recovery. The 22-year-old broke his fibula and dislocated his ankle in Bayern's 2-0 loss to Paris Saint-Germain in the Club World Cup quarter-finals. Advertisement The playmaker will now be out for several months. Sané will be one of the candidates to fill in for him for Germany in upcoming World Cup qualifiers, but he can no longer replace Musiala for Bayern after recently leaving for Galatasaray. "I really hope he recovers soon. Bayern and the national team need him and his brilliant moments," the 29-year-old told Sky. "He was just on his way to becoming 100% fit again, and then this... I feel so incredibly sorry for him. It's so frustrating." Musiala underwent successful surgery on Monday. "I watched the game live on TV," Sané said. "The scene didn't look good at all after the first replay. Unfortunately, you could already sense that it would mean a longer recovery period. It's unbelievably bitter. I was stunned at first."

Galatasaray consider move for Roma keeper Svilar
Turkish club Galatasaray are weighing up a move for Roma goalkeeper Mile Svilar, reports in Italy claim. According to today's edition of La Repubblica, via CalcioMercato, the Super Lig outfit view the Roma star as the perfect successor to Fernando Muslera, who left the club this summer after 14 years. Advertisement The reports suggest that whilst no official negotiations are underway as of yet, Galatasaray are encouraged by the fact Svilar has yet to sign his contract extension with the Giallorossi. (Photo by) Will Svilar stay or will he go? The highly rated 25-year-old has just finished an impressive season. The former Benfica man was named Serie A goalkeeper of the season for the 2024-25 campaign and Roma are preparing to offer him a new deal to reflect his increased status. However, now Galatasaray look set to come knocking. The Turkish side are undertaking a massive overhaul, with Leroy Sane joining on a free from Bayern Munich, the club attempting to sign Victor Osimhen permanently and Inter duo Yann Sommer and Hakan Calhanoglu both linked with moves to the club. Paris Saint-Germain v Bayern Munich: Club World Cup quarter-final
Update: Date: 2025-07-05T14:47:12.000Z Title: Early team news: Content: Ousmane Dembele missed all three group games through injury but returned as a substitute for his side's win over Inter Miami in the first knockout round. The winger was sent off in PSG's defeat at the hands of Bayern in November and will be hoping to make amends if he gets a run-out today. Bayern Munich will be without Leroy Sane, who departed the club to join Galatasaray on a free transfer when his contract expired the day after he helped the German side beat Flamengo last weekend. Alphonso Davies (ACL) and Hiroki Ito (broken foot) remain sidelined, while Kim Min-jae (achilles) is nearing full fitness but seems unlikely to feature in this tournament. Due to leave Bayern as soon as their interest in the Club World Cup ends, Thomas Muller could make his 756th and final appearance for the club in Atlanta today. Update: Date: 2025-07-05T14:45:15.000Z Title: Quarter-final: PSG v Bayern Munich Content: A much maligned vanity project and Fifa cash and power grab, the Club World Cup 2.0 has now reached that point where, whatever their feelings about having to travel stateside for up to a month at the end of a gruelling season, the remaining teams will now be of a mind that seeing as they've made it this far, they might as well try to go a little further. Chelsea and the Brazilian side Fluminense have already made it to the last four and in a few hours one of PSG and Bayern Munich will join them. The European heavyweights meet for a noon showdown at the Mercedes-Benz Stadium in Atlanta, Georgia, a 75,000-capacity venue that is normally home to the NFL's Atlanta Falcons and MLS's Atlanta United. Notable for its iconic retractable roof and 360-degree halo video display, it is unlikely to be full given that Fifa were struggling to sell reduced price tickets for its upper tiers during the week at a cut-price $44. Assuming the pinwheel roof is closed for today's match, any potential last-minute walk-ups are unlikely to be put off by the forecast 32C heat forecast for Atlanta this afternoon. The cool conditions inside this EnormoDome will also suit the aggressive pressing style so synonymous with both Bayern and PSG. Kick-off is at 5pm (BST) but stay tuned in the meantime for team news and build-up.
